Output 34f97bcf6b01501f2e6c5953a49c850bbf59d0a2fe072efae395af9f85f2f55d:0

value
24566034480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 61ca1ad88e9d8ac1aec0124b95d75b1336867e09 OP_EQUALVERIFY OP_CHECKSIG
address
LU91vK6qhdyFkgadyDBYAF3d6d8bnWG1Hp
transaction
34f97bcf6b01501f2e6c5953a49c850bbf59d0a2fe072efae395af9f85f2f55d
spent
true